Skip to product information
1 of 1

Edelbrock

Edelbrock 8844 WATER PUMP

Edelbrock 8844 WATER PUMP

SKU: 8844

In Stock

Regular price $305.95 USD
Regular price Sale price $305.95 USD
Sale Sold out
Shipping calculated at checkout.

WATER PUMP 70-79 351C

View full details